System Error

Today I spent six hours reinstalling my work laptop.

I can't believe it. This is a top of the line machine. It shouldn't need such a drastic reconstruction.

See, both Netscape and Internet Explorer started acting oddly this morning. From best to worst, one of the following happened every time I tried to use them:

* The browser would not display large pages correctly.

* The browser would crash without warning.

* The system would crash to the login screen.

* The system would crash to the boot up screen.

Every time. And I hadn't even changed anything. It just happened. Yes, over the last couple weeks, I've had the odd system problem, but nothing like this.

Sigh.

Went through hell reinstalling too. I contacted Les the Mac Consultant, who advised me on how to possibly fix the solution.

We checked the hardware diagnostics. All fine. Since this was happening in both browsers, it must then be a problem with the operating system.

We couldn't reinstall OS X, as my predecessor installed it off his own disks. So we had to remove it and revert to 9.1. So we yanked it and reinstalled the old operating system.

Of course it didn't work. Remnants of the old system confused the computer, and it refused to boot up.

I did a system restoration while trying to retain the existing file system. No dice. I tried doing a system restoration with a disk wipe. Again, no dice.

Finally, I had to completely reinitialize the hard disk, eliminating the partitions and wiping every last bit of data from it. The reinstall worked finally, and then I spent two more hours reinstalling the software I needed.

I didn't accomplish much today.
